Re: TL-150 general supervisory errors?



On Nov 28, 4:21=A0pm, Jim Rojas <jro...@xxxxxxxxxxxx> wrote:
> Tower Security wrote:
> > Here's a bit of an update on what we've done...
>
> > DSC tech support felt it was the router so to test that theory we put
> > in a plain switch behind the cable modem and split the signal to the
> > TL-150 and the router - effectively putting the TL-150 in front of the
> > router and we've experienced no supervisory troubles since. =A0So while
> > we've determined that the router is indeed the cause, in its current
> > configuration FWIW there is the concern of the login interface being
> > exposed to the internet...
>
> > BTW, the above work-around will only work if your service provider
> > will grant you at least two IP addresses.
>
> Did you try configuring the TLink in the router DMZ?
>
> Jim Rojas

He'd still have the same potential hack issues from the outside, in
the end it's no different doing that than what he has now.
